The GA 1017 is an aluminium general-purpose trim with a 20.0mm single-slot gap — the widest-gap edge trim in GA’s miscellaneous channel range and the specification for structural-gauge board materials. This is a single-slot edge cap: it slides onto one board or panel edge, capping the raw face with a continuous aluminium trim that protects the material and gives the edge a finished metal appearance. At 20mm, it handles the heavy-duty board thicknesses used in structural fit-out, manufacturing, and workshop construction — not the light-gauge display and cabinetry materials suited to the narrower profiles in the range.
The 20.0mm gap accommodates 18mm and 19mm materials: standard structural plywood and MDF, thicker composite panels, worktop substrates, and engineered board used in counters, workbenches, and heavy-duty joinery. The wider face of the trim that results from this greater gap also provides a more substantial edge contact area — relevant when the panel edge is subject to mechanical loads, regular impact, or is in a position where a more prominent edge detail is appropriate.
Manufactured from grade 6063 aluminium alloy to BS EN 755, 515, and 573 standards. Available from stock in mill (untreated) or natural anodised finish in 4-metre lengths. Powder coat and cut lengths available to order.
N.B. Jig marks, up to 50mm in from each end (often less than this), can be apparent on anodised items. These marks can be cut away before fixing.
Shade variations can occur with anodised surfaces due to the reactive nature of this finishing process.

Product Code: GA 1017 (Mill) / GA 1017s (Natural Anodised)
Gap Width: 20.0mm
Suitable Material Thickness: Typically, 18–19mm (structural MDF, plywood, thick composite boards, worktop substrates) — refer to the dimensional drawing for precise tolerances
Profile Function: Single-slot edge trim/cap — finishes and protects ONE panel or board edge (not a panel-to-panel connector)
Profile Category: Miscellaneous Channel — Single-Slot Edge Trim
Material: Grade 6063 Aluminium Alloy
Standards: BS EN 755, BS EN 515, BS EN 573
Anodising Standard: BS EN ISO 7599
Powder Coating Standard: BS 6496 (1984) — available to order, please contact Sales
Length: 4 metres (4000mm) standard stock length
Available Finishes: Mill (Untreated) or Natural Anodised
Processing Services: Cutting to length (straight and mitre), hole drilling, rolling and curving — contact Sales Team
Finish Notes: Anodised product codes carry an ‘s’ suffix. Jig marks within 50mm of each end are standard and can be trimmed during final fitting. Shade variations may occur between batches.
Surface Marking Test: Independent testing (Ceram / Lucideon): anodised surface achieved 4× greater abrasion resistance than mill finish
Sized for Structural Board — 18mm MDF and Plywood: 18mm MDF and structural plywood are the go-to board thicknesses when panels need to carry mechanical loads, span between supports, or resist impact in demanding environments. The GA 1017’s 20mm gap is matched to these materials, providing a 2mm working tolerance that accommodates the slight variation in thickness that occurs across structural board batches, while keeping the trim snug on the panel edge.
Wider Flange Contact Area for Greater Edge Protection: The wider the gap, the wider the profile’s flange face — and the more surface contact the trim has with the board edge. For 18mm board subject to mechanical loads, trolley impact, or forklift incursion in industrial environments, the GA 1017’s broader contact face distributes these forces across more of the panel edge, reducing the likelihood of the trim being displaced or the board edge splitting under impact.
Protects Structural Boards from Moisture at the Edge Face: Raw structural MDF and plywood edges are highly absorbent. In damp environments — commercial kitchens, warehouses, covered outdoor areas — moisture ingress through an unprotected board edge causes swelling, delamination, and structural failure over time. The GA 1017 seals the edge with a non-porous aluminium cap that prevents this, extending the service life of structural board installations in conditions where the board face would otherwise be adequately protected but the edge would not.
Independent Test Data Supports Anodised Finish Choice: For the GA 1017 in heavy-duty or industrial settings, the anodised finish option carries specific, documented performance benefits. Ceram Building Technology (now Lucideon) tested anodised aluminium extrusion surfaces under abrasive conditions and found they withstand up to four times as many passes before visible marking compared with mill finish. In workshop, warehouse, and manufacturing environments where the trim edge is regularly contacted by equipment, materials, and personnel, this difference in surface hardness is practically relevant.
Mill Finish the Right Call for Fabrication and Welded Assemblies: Where the GA 1017 is being used as a component in a welded or fabricated assembly, the mill (untreated) finish is the appropriate specification. Mill finish aluminium welds and bonds cleanly, and presents a consistent surface for subsequent powder coating or painting, if an applied finish is specified for the completed fabrication. For structural applications where the trim will be incorporated into a larger assembly rather than left as a standalone edge detail, mill finish is the practical choice.
Workbench Tops, Counters & Workshop Surfaces: 18mm plywood and MDF are the standard substrate for workbench tops, production line surfaces, laboratory benches, and commercial counters. These surfaces have exposed front and end edges that receive daily impact from tools, equipment, and materials. The GA 1017 provides the edge cap that protects these high-risk edges from splitting, chipping, and moisture ingress, while presenting a clean metal edge line.
Warehouse Shelving & Racking Panel Edges: Heavy-duty shelving systems and storage racking built from 18mm board have exposed shelf edges at a consistent height — in the direct path of goods being moved by hand, pallet truck, or forklift. The GA 1017 provides the edge protection needed to prevent these edges from being knocked, split, or delaminated by routine material handling, and the aluminium construction means the trim itself will not corrode in the humid or variable-temperature conditions typical of warehouse storage.
Structural Joinery & Bespoke Cabinetry Edge Treatment: For bespoke joinery work where structural plywood or thick MDF is used as the carcass material and the piece will be used in a demanding setting — a commercial kitchen, a contract-specification hotel room, a built-in storage installation in a public building — the GA 1017 provides the structural board edge with a metal trim that is more durable and more visually robust than edge banding or painted edge filler.
Manufacturing Jigs, Templates & Production Tooling: In manufacturing and engineering environments, 18mm board is commonly used for production jigs, routing templates, press platens, and assembly fixtures. These items have multiple exposed edges that are handled repeatedly and subject to mechanical stress from the production process. The GA 1017 protects these edges from damage that would compromise the accuracy of the jig or template, extending the working life of tooling that would otherwise need to be replaced when edge damage makes it dimensionally unreliable.
